  • the present invention relates to the field of communications, and more particularly, to a random access probe transmitting method, apparatus, and mobile terminal, which can be applied to a wireless cellular communication system.
  • the system contains a certain number of base stations, each of which needs to communicate with a certain number of users simultaneously.
  • User terminals are randomly dispersed throughout the coverage of the base station of the communication system. After the mobile terminal captures the mobile network, it is usually in standby. When the user terminal needs to communicate with the base station, a random access procedure needs to be initiated. Therefore, random access technology plays an important role in various wireless communication multiple access systems.
  • the random access channel usually consists of a probe (or prefix) and a message.
  • the function of the probe is to achieve uplink synchronization, carrying random IDs and other information.
  • the message part usually carries connection request information and the like.
  • the random access procedure is performed as follows.
  • the mobile terminal randomly selects a probe as a random access probe in the random access candidate probe sequence, and sends the probe to the base station.
  • the base station captures the random access probe, it sends an acknowledgement message to the terminal on the forward channel.
  • the terminal sends a connection establishment request to the base station.
  • the base station allocates a reverse link channel resource to the terminal, and notifies the mobile terminal through the downlink channel.
  • the transmission mechanism and method of the random access probe have an important influence on whether the base station can quickly acquire the random access probe.
  • the timeliness of random access is different. For example, real-time services require higher timeliness for random access than data services, and real-time services require higher timeliness for random access during cell edge handover.
  • the random access procedure of the related art does not optimize the transmission process of the random access sequence for different environmental characteristics, and thus the performance is low.
  • the method for transmitting the random access probe is as follows: As shown in FIG. 1, when the mobile terminal sends the random access probe, the probe 1 is sent at a lower power first. After a fixed period of time, increase the power transmission probe 2 until the maximum number of shots Np is reached.
  • the initial power of the transmission is determined by:
  • dBm is the power unit; the average received power is the power at which the terminal detects the downlink signal of the base station; the open loop adjustment is the difference between the initial access power and the average received power.
  • the value of the open loop adjustment is broadcast by the base station to the mobile terminal. All mobile terminals use the same open loop adjustment when initiating access. The increased value is given in increments of the step parameter each time the power is sent to the probe.
  • the value of the incremental step is broadcast by the base station to the mobile terminal, and all mobile terminals use the same incremental step when initiating access.
  • the Access Cycle Duration of the probe is also broadcast by the base station to the mobile terminal, and all mobile terminals use the same interval size when initiating access.
  • the random access probes are sent in the same manner, and the priority of the random access initiated in different environments cannot be reflected.
  • the random access procedure with low priority and the random access procedure with high priority compete for channel resources equally, so that the random access procedure with low priority has a random access procedure with high priority. Large interference is formed, which reduces the efficiency of random access.

本发明涉及通信领域, 并且更特别地, 涉及一种随机接入探针发送方法、 装置及移动终端, 其可以应用于无线蜂窝通信系统。
背景技术
当前的无线移动通信系统都需要支持一定数量的用户终端。系统包含一定 数量的基站, 每个基站需要和一定数量的用户同时通信。
用户终端随机分散在整个通信系统的基站覆盖范围内。移动终端捕获移动 网络后, 通常处于待机状态。 当用户终端需要和基站进行通信时, 需要发起随 机接入过程。因此,随机接入技术在各种无线通信多址接入系统占重要的地位。
随机接入信道通常由探针(或前缀)和消息两部分组成。 探针的功能是实 现上行同步,携带随机 ID及其他信息等。 消息部分通常携带连接请求信息等。
通常情况下, 随机接入过程按如下方法进行。移动终端在需要建立上行链 路时,在随机接入候选探针序列里随机选择某一探针作为随机接入探针,发送 给基站。 基站捕获随机接入探针后, 在前向信道给终端发送确认消息。 终端收 到确认消息后, 向基站发送连接建立请求。 基站收到连接建立请求后, 给终端 分配反向链路信道资源, 并通过下行信道通知移动终端。
在随机接入过程中,随机接入探针的发送机制和方法对于基站是否能快速 捕获随机接入探针有重要影响。 而不同环境下, 系统对随机接入的及时性不一 样。 例如, 实时的业务对随机接入的及时性要求比数据业务的高, 实时业务在 小区边缘的切换过程中对随机接入的及时性要求更高等。
通过上述描述可以看出,相关技术的随机接入过程没有针对不同环境特点 优化随机接入序列的发送过程, 因此性能较低。
例如, 在无线通信标准 802.20中, 随机接入探针的发送方法如下: 如图 1所示,移动终端发送随机接入探针时,先以较低的功率发送探针 1 , 以后间隔一段固定时间, 增大功率发送探针 2, 直到达到最大发射数量 Np为 止。
其中, 发射的初始功率由下式决定:
初始接入功率 = -平均接收功率 (dBm) +开环调节
其中, dBm是功率单位; 平均接收功率是终端检测到基站下行信号的功 率; 开环调节是初始接入功率相对于平均接收功率的差值。 在该协议中, 开环 调节的数值由基站广播给移动终端。所有移动终端发起接入时釆用相同的开环 调节。 每次增大功率发送探针时, 增大的数值以递增步长参数给出。 在该协议 中, 递增步长的数值有基站广播给移动终端, 所有移动终端发起接入时釆用相 同的递增步长。 此外, 在该协议中, 探针发送的间隔参数 (Access Cycle Duration )也由基站广播给移动终端, 所有移动终端发起接入时釆用相同的间 隔大小。
这样, 对于该小区中所有的终端, 随机接入探针釆用相同的方法发送, 导 致不同环境下发起的随机接入的优先级不能得到体现。这样一来,优先级低的 随机接入过程和优先级高的随机接入过程相互之间同等地竟争信道资源,从而 使优先级低的随机接入过程对优先级高的随机接入过程形成较大的干扰,降低 了随机接入的效率。

参考图 2 , 根据本发明第一实施例的随机接入探针发送方法包括以下步 骤: S202, 根据特定因素将随机接入探针划分为不同的优先级; S204, 移动终 端确定用于发起随机接入的当前随机接入探针的优先级; 以及 S206, 移动终 端根据当前随机接入探针的优先级来设置发送当前随机接入探针的相关参数。
其中, 特定因素包括紧急程度、 和 /或服务质量。 紧急程度越高, 随机接 入探针的优先级越高; 和 /或服务质量越高, 随机接入探针的优先级越高。 举 例来说, 紧急电话、 处于连接状态的切换、 尝试多次的实时业务接入、 实时业 务、 以及数据业务的随机接入探针的优先级依次递减。
特别地, 可以根据基站负载来调整优先级, 在基站负载重的情况下, 可以 将随机接入探针的优先级降低, 在基站负载轻的情况下, 可以将随机接入探针 的优先级升高。
其中, 在 S204中, 移动终端根据发起随机接入的具体环境来确定随机接 入探针的优先级。
另外,在 S206中设置的相关参数包括发送初始功率、发送功率递增步长、 发送间隔。 其中, 发送初始功率 =平均接收功率 +开环调节, 其中, 通过改变 开环调节的大小来改变发送初始功率的大小。
特别地, 对于优先级不同的随机接入探针, 在 S206中设置的相关参数可 以部分地或全部不同, 并且至少有一个不同。
其中, A优先级的随机接入探针的发送初始功率大于或等于 B优先级的 随机接入探针的发送初始功率; A优先级的随机接入探针的递增步长大于或等 于 B优先级的随机接入探针的递增步长; A优先级的随机接入探针的发送间 隔小于或等于 B优先级的随机接入探针的发送间隔; 其中, A优先级比 B优 先级的优先级高一级。发送随机接入探针的功率递增, 直到达到系统允许的最 大发射功率。
实例 1
下面参考图 3来说明根据本发明第一实施例的优先级实例 1。如图 3所示, 根据发起接入时的环境将随机接入探针的优先级分为三个等级。第一优先级是 实时业务的终端在发起小区切换时发送的随机接入探针。第二优先级是实时业 务上行链路初始化时发送的随机接入探针。其他的随机接入探针归为第三优先 级。 在图 3所示的实例中, 不同优先级的随机接入探针的递增步长不同。如图 3所示, 第二优先级的探针序列的递增步长比第三优先级的递增步长要大, 所 以只要 Np-1次就达到了第三优先级中的最大发射功率。 第一优先级的初始发 射功率大于第二优先级的初始发射功率, 发射的次数为 Np-2。 由此可以看出, 相同信道条件下, 第一优先级的随机接入探针能够更快地 站捕获到, 因此 能够更好地满足业务的实时性需要。
实例 2
下面参考图 4来说明根据本发明第一实施例的优先级实例 2。
如图 4 所示, 在本实例中, 将业务分为三个优先级, 分组方法和实例 1 相同, 但是三种优先级的探针发送时的参数和实例 1的不同。 如图 4所示, 第 一和第二优先级具有比第三优先级较短的发送间隔,这样可以减少优先级低的 用户对优先级高的用户的干扰。第一优先级比第二优先级有较大的发射初始功 率和递增步长, 可以使第一优先级的比第二优先级的更容易接入。
从以上具体实施方式可知,本发明提供的应用于无线蜂窝通信系统的高效 随机接入探针发送方法包括以下处理: 首先,将各种环境下发送的随机接入探 针根据紧急程度或服务质量(Qos, Quality of service ) 区分优先级; 然后, 移 动终端根据发起随机接入的具体环境确定当前随机接入探针的优先级; 然后, 移动终端根据当前的优先级确定随机接入探针的发送方式:对于优先级不同的 随机接入探针, 发送时全部或部分发送参数(发送初始功率, 递增步长, 发送 间隔等)设置不一样。优先级高一级的发送初始功率大于或等于优先级低一级 的, 递增步长大于或等于优先级低一级的,发送间隔小于或等于优先级低一级 的。 以上参数至少有一个不相等。 发送探针的功率每次递增, 直到达到系统允 许的最大发射功率为止。
